ABSTRACT

The pathogenesis of overactive bladder syndrome (OAB) is still unclear.Although OAB is defined as " overactive bladder" , the lesion is not confined to the bladder, studies have been showed that urethral instability (URI) can also induce symptom of OAB.The author has observed 146 children with OAB and found that URI is one of the causes of OAB, and also has a significant effect on the treatment of OAB.Recently, the role of URI played in OAB has gradually been emphasized, however, the research of URI is still controversial.At present, the first-line treatment of OAB is mainly anticholinergic drugs for the detrusor overactivity, and lack of diagnosis and related treatment mea-sures in urethral dysfunction.The updated progress of URI in children with OAB were summarized in this review.

ABSTRACT

Overactive bladder(OAB) is a clinical syndrome which mainly defined by urinary urgency,and it is mainly diagnosed by clinical manifestations.The pathophysiological mechanisms include detrusor overactive,urethral instability and other neurological or psychiatric factors.Obviously,the dysfunction of detrusor and urethral sphincter can not be diagnosed accurately that consequently affects the treatment significantly by clinical symptoms.Recently,the urodynamic evaluation is recommended for more precise diagnose of OAB.In addition,it has been reported that urinary nerve growth factor and autonomic nervous system function could be used to diagnose OAB in children.The updated techniques diagnosis of OAB in children are summarized in this review.

ABSTRACT

Objective To investigate the current situation and existing problems of healthcare-associated infection (HAI)management in primary medical institutions in Henan Province.Methods 36 primary medical institutions in 18 regions were investigated with random sampling method,development of HAI management in primary medical institutions before and after 2013 were compared.Results Among 36 primary medical institutions,31 (86.11 %) had cleaning,disinfection,sterilization,and isolation systems,13 (36.11 %)implemented HAI monitoring system, 31 (86.11 %)performed regular training on hand hygiene knowledge,6 (16.67%)allocated antimicrobial manage-ment professionals.The development rates in HAI management group,hand hygiene system,training on related knowledge among staff,HAI monitoring,and antimicrobial management in 36 primary medical institutions before 2013 were all lower than those after 2013 (41 .67% VS 75.00%;2.78% VS 30.56%;22.22% VS 69.44%;5.56%VS 33.33%;25.00% VS 66.67%,all P <0.05).Conclusion HAI management level in primary medical institu-tions has improved than before,but deficiencies still exists and needs further improvement.

ABSTRACT

Objective To investigate the current situation of healthcare-associated infection(HAI)organization management systems in primary medical institutions.Methods 95 primary medical institutions in 5 provinces (au-tonomous regions,municipalities)in China were investigated.Results Of 95 primary medical institutions,82 (86.32%)established HAI management groups,65 (68.42%)set up antimicrobial management departments,87 (91.58%)assigned professionals for antimicrobial management.Before 2010,only 26 antimicrobial management departments were set up,which increased to 65(68.42%)in 2015.Hospitals established rules and regulations on medical waste management (n=93,97.89%),disinfection and sterilization(n = 87,91.58%),disposable sterile medical device (n=87,91.58%),HAI prevention and control measures (n=79,83.16%),occupational health and safety protection for health care workers(n=76,80.00%),outbreak reporting system (n=73,76.84%),hand hygiene (n=69,72.63%),and monitoring on HAI (n=56,58.95%).Conclusion Current situation of HAI or-ganization management systems in primary medical institutions needs to be improved,health administrative depart-ments should strengthen supervision to improve the level of HAI prevention and control.
